Obviously hard to tell, but at this time of year I do tend to suspect tires. Personally I do not rate all season tires for bad snow or storms. I have proper full winter tires on separate rims from November to April for any car that is driven all year.
Looking at the Taycan , these are the most expensive rims available from Porsche, so my guess is no winter tires fitted.

I have those wheels on my Taycan - definitely tires I would not want to use in the winter! The 305W in the rear is like a pair of tobaggans. I bought a set of 20" winters - it works, but the ground clearance is so low.
